Early life and career
Bobby Orrock was born on November 13, 1955, in Fredericksburg, Virginia. He completed his secondary education at Ladysmith High School in Caroline County, graduating in 1974. Following high school, Orrock pursued higher education, initially attending Germanna Community College for one year. He then transferred to Virginia Tech, where he earned a Bachelor of Science degree in agricultural education in 1978. Orrock continued his academic journey and obtained a Master of Education degree in the same field from Virginia State University in 1988.
In addition to his educational qualifications, Orrock has had a long-standing career in agricultural education. He is a semi-retired teacher at Spotsylvania High School, where he has contributed to the education of many students in the field of agriculture. His commitment to community service is evident through his involvement with the Ladysmith Volunteer Rescue Squad, where he has served since 1973. Over the years, he has taken on leadership roles, becoming a trustee for both the Ladysmith and Spotsylvania County Volunteer Rescue Squads. Furthermore, Orrock is a certified hunter safety instructor with the Virginia Department of Game and Inland Fisheries, showcasing his dedication to promoting safety and education in outdoor activities.
In his personal life, Orrock experienced the loss of his first spouse but later remarried Debra Orrock, née Shelton, in 2017. He also engages with the community through media, serving as a part-time emcee for a Sunday morning gospel radio show on WFLS-FM, which broadcasts from Fredericksburg, Virginia.
Legislative service
Bobby Orrock's political career began with his election to the Virginia House of Delegates, where he represented the 54th district. His tenure in the legislature is marked by two distinct terms. During his time in office, Orrock was involved in various committees that addressed a range of issues pertinent to his constituents and the state of Virginia. He served on the Agriculture Committee during two separate periods, from 1990 to 1993 and again from 1995 to 2001. This involvement highlighted his commitment to agricultural issues, which aligned with his professional background.
In addition to the Agriculture Committee, Orrock was also a member of the Chesapeake and Its Tributaries Committee from 1990 to 1994, reflecting his interest in environmental and natural resource issues. His legislative focus expanded further when he became a member of the Agriculture, Chesapeake, and Natural Resources Committee starting in 2002. This committee work allowed him to address a broader range of topics related to agriculture and environmental policy.
Orrock's leadership capabilities were recognized when he was appointed as Co-Chairman of the Agriculture Committee from 2000 to 2001. He later took on the role of Chairman of the Health, Welfare, and Institutions Committee in 2010, a position he held continuously for many years. This committee is crucial for addressing health policy and welfare issues in Virginia, and Orrock's leadership in this area underscored his influence in shaping health-related legislation.
Throughout his legislative career, Orrock also participated in the Counties, Cities, and Towns Committee from 1994 to 2009, as well as the Finance Committee during two periods, from 1998 to 2005 and again from 2010 onward. His involvement in these committees allowed him to engage with various aspects of governance, including fiscal policy and local government issues. Additionally, he served on the Mining and Mineral Resources Committee for a brief period from 2000 to 2001 and the Rules Committee starting in 2012.

Policy focus and district
During his time in the Virginia House of Delegates, Bobby Orrock's policy focus was primarily centered on agriculture, health, and welfare, reflecting both his professional background and the needs of his constituents. His deep understanding of agricultural education informed his work on committees that addressed agricultural issues, allowing him to advocate for policies that supported farmers and agricultural businesses in Virginia. This focus was particularly relevant to the 54th district, which encompasses areas with significant agricultural activity.
The 54th district, which Orrock represented, includes parts of Caroline and Spotsylvania counties. Caroline County is situated within the Greater Richmond Region, while Spotsylvania County is part of the Washington metropolitan area.
